Job description

Job Introduction

The BBC Media Planning team execute campaigns across a multitude of touchpoints to ensure all audiences across the UK are aware of the great content and brands that the BBC produce. By utilising the BBC own inventory (TV and Radio trails, Digital Display and Pre-rolls), alongside a presence in (largely digital) paid channels, activity for shows such as Waterloo Road and Happy Valley cut through to audiences and drive consumption

Main Responsibilities

Campaign Planners are responsible for the management and delivery of marketing promotions to audiences.
